This unit includes my listings titled Polynomial Functions Lessons 1-7 and Polynomial Functions Lesson 2 and 4 Quiz. When purchased as a unit, you save $6!
General topics covered in this unit are: identifying polynomials, graphing polynomials, polynomial long division, synthetic division, remainder theorem, rational zeros theorem, graphing rational functions, and solving rational functions (for a more complete topic list, please visit my individual Polynomial Functions Lesson listings).

CCSSHSA-APR.A.1
Understand that polynomials form a system analogous to the integers, namely, they are closed under the operations of addition, subtraction, and multiplication; add, subtract, and multiply polynomials.
CCSSHSA-APR.B.2
Know and apply the Remainder Theorem: For a polynomial π±(πΉ) and a number π’, the remainder on division by πΉ β π’ is π±(π’), so π±(π’) = 0 if and only if (πΉ β π’) is a factor of π±(πΉ).
CCSSHSA-APR.B.3
Identify zeros of polynomials when suitable factorizations are available, and use the zeros to construct a rough graph of the function defined by the polynomial.
